Study on Application of Gob-side Entry Retaining with Flexible Filling Materials in Large Mining Height and Soft Coal Seam
Aiming at the stability of the surrounding rock of gob-side entry retaining in Liangbei coal mine,a collab-orative control technology for the surrounding rock which integrates"pre-cracking of the roof,pre-support in road-way,and high-water rapid solidifying materials filling in roadway-side"is proposed.Based on laboratory tests,theo-retical analysis,engineering analogy,numerical simulation and other methods,the support parameters of pre-crack-ing,pre-support and gob-side wall with high-water rapid solidifying materials filling in the conveyor roadway of the 21051 east coal seam face were determined.The on-site monitoring results show that the deformation of the surrounding rock within a range of 120 m of the working face is increasing and then tends to stabilize.The final deformation is with-in a controllable range,and the success of retaining the roadway has been achieved.The relevant technical methods can provide a certain reference for similar gob-side entry retaining in mines.
